ABC Cancels 'Brothers & Sisters'
Calista Flockhart and Sally Field's family drama Brothers & Sisters has been canceled.
The show's recent fifth season will be its last - due to falling ratings. The finale airs Sunday night.
Brothers & Sisters also featured Rachel Griffiths, Patricia Wettig, Rob Lowe, Ron Rifkin and Dave Annable among its all-star cast.
Field won a 2007 Outstanding Lead Actress Emmy Award for her portrayal of matriarch Nora Walker on the TV drama.

Sally Field Joins ABC's 'Brothers & Sisters'
Sally Field has signed on to play the mother of Calista Flockhart and Rachel Griffiths in the new TV drama Brothers & Sisters. The Oscar-winning actress has replaced Betty Buckley, who played the matriarch in the pilot.
Field, who turns 60 in November, will play the mother of five adult children on the show, including Balthazar Getty, Dave Annable and Welsh newcomer Matthew Rhys.
This will be Field's first regular primetime role since 2002's short-lived ABC drama “The Court.” She previously appeared on TV drama ER which netted her an Emmy award.

Calista Flockart Returns To The Small Screen
Former Ally McBeal star Calista Flockhart is returning to TV in the drama series "Brothers And Sisters." The actress will join star Rachel Griffiths in the nighttime soap, which features siblings who wind up running the family business after their father dies. The show will mark Flockhart's first return to regular TV series since Ally McBeal ended its run in 2002.
Griffiths was last seen as Brenda Chenowith on Six Feet Under, which finished last year. The actresses will join cast members Balthazar Getty and Ron Rifkin for the new show.
